The Department of Science and Technology-Science Education Institute (DOST-SEI), in cooperation with the National Consortium in Graduate Science and Mathematics Education (NCGSME), offers scholarships to qualified male and female applicants for the pursuance of Master’s and Doctorate degrees in Science and Mathematics Education under the Capacity Building Program in Science and Mathematics Education (CBPSME).
Objectives
The program aims to:
- improve the quality of science and mathematics education in the country; and
- accelerate the development of critical mass of experts in science and mathematics education
Components
- Master’s in Mathematics / Science Education
- Doctoral in Mathematics / Science Education
Criteria for Eligibility
- Natural-born Filipino citizen;
- Not more than 50 years old at the time of application;
- In good health and of good moral character;
- Pass the admission requirements for graduate studies at any of the
NCGSME member-universities; - Have at least two years teaching experience in science and mathematics for Doctoral; or at least one year teaching experience or have graduated with academic honors or graduated as DOST scholar for
Master’s;- If employed: Allowed to study full-time for two or three years
(Residential Mode) and part-time for six years at UPOU (Distance
Education Mode); and - For employees of the DepEd: Officially endorsed by DepEd (Signed
Form 2A by Division Superintendent and Regional Director) - Must have been in service for at least five (5) years.
- Must have at least Very Satisfactory performance
rating for the last two (2) years. - For employed non-DepEd applicants: Certificate of Employment,
Permit to Study (Signed Form 2B by the Head of the University);
- If employed: Allowed to study full-time for two or three years
- Not a recipient of other scholarship; and
- Willing to accept the terms and conditions specified in the
Scholarship Contract.

Incentive
The stipends in the remaining months of the scholarship period shall be given to a scholar who completes his/her degree earlier than the end of the said period
Who else may apply?
- PhD graduate in a priority S&T program (scholar or non-scholar) who intends to pursue a second PhD degree.
- MS/PhD non-scholar graduate (not S&T related) who intends to pursue a second MS/PhD degree.
Who may NO longer apply?
- PhD graduate (scholar or non-scholar) who intends to pursue another MS degree program.
- MS graduate in a priority S&T program (scholar or non-scholar) who intends to pursue a second MS degree.
